// -----   Public method GetMass   -----------------------------------------
Double_t FairMCTrack::GetMass() const
{
  if ( TDatabasePDG::Instance() ) {
    TParticlePDG* particle = TDatabasePDG::Instance()->GetParticle(fPdgCode);
    if ( particle ) { return particle->Mass(); }
    else { return 0.; }
  }
  return 0.;
}
// -------------------------------------------------------------------------




// -----   Public method GetRapidity   -------------------------------------
Double_t FairMCTrack::GetRapidity() const
{
  Double_t e = GetEnergy();
  Double_t y = 0.5 * TMath::Log( (e+fPz) / (e-fPz) );
  return y;
}
// -------------------------------------------------------------------------




// -----   Public method GetNPoints   --------------------------------------
Int_t FairMCTrack::GetNPoints(DetectorId detId) const
{
  // TODO: Where does this come from
  if      ( detId == kREF  ) { return (  fNPoints &   1); }
  else if ( detId == kTutDet  ) { return ( (fNPoints & ( 7 <<  1) ) >>  1); }
  else if ( detId == kFairRutherford ) { return ( (fNPoints & (31 <<  4) ) >>  4); }
  else {
    cout << "-E- FairMCTrack::GetNPoints: Unknown detector ID "
         << detId << endl;
    return 0;
  }
}
// -------------------------------------------------------------------------



// -----   Public method SetNPoints   --------------------------------------
void FairMCTrack::SetNPoints(Int_t iDet, Int_t nPoints)
{

  if ( iDet == kREF ) {
    if      ( nPoints < 0 ) { nPoints = 0; }
    else if ( nPoints > 1 ) { nPoints = 1; }
    fNPoints = ( fNPoints & ( ~ 1 ) )  |  nPoints;
  }

  else if ( iDet == kTutDet ) {
    if      ( nPoints < 0 ) { nPoints = 0; }
    else if ( nPoints > 7 ) { nPoints = 7; }
    fNPoints = ( fNPoints & ( ~ (  7 <<  1 ) ) )  |  ( nPoints <<  1 );
  }

  else if ( iDet == kFairRutherford ) {
    if      ( nPoints <  0 ) { nPoints =  0; }
    else if ( nPoints > 31 ) { nPoints = 31; }
    fNPoints = ( fNPoints & ( ~ ( 31 <<  4 ) ) )  |  ( nPoints <<  4 );
  }

  else cout << "-E- FairMCTrack::SetNPoints: Unknown detector ID "
              << iDet << endl;

}
